n8n & Notion: Break E-commerce Vendor Lock-in

E-commerce stores often face the challenge of vendor lock-in and platform dependency, where they rely heavily on third-party services for their operations. This can limit their ability to customize and adapt to changing business needs, making it difficult to scale and innovate. By leveraging n8n’s webhook-based automation and integrating with Notion, e-commerce stores can create a self-hosted backend that listens for incoming webhooks from external services, allowing them to transform their Notion workspace from a passive knowledge repository into an actionable backend. This approach enables stores to remove vendor dependency, increase flexibility, and automate their workflows, ultimately driving growth and competitiveness.
